I spent four hours upgrading Athena, the AI Chief of Staff that runs my consulting operations. Before executing the changes, I gave her the upgrade plan to review. She came back with three objections, including asking us not to claim she could "learn from experience" when the learning system wasn't connected yet. This isn't anthropomorphizing a chatbot. It's what happens when you give AI systems enough context to have useful opinions about their own limitations. Anthropic's own research backs this up — their models are showing early signs of genuine introspective awareness. The question for every business running AI in production: are you building systems where your tools can flag their own failures, or are you trusting confident-sounding output?

Most "actionable prompts" are boring and you forget them immediately. This one might make you uncomfortable. Copy this into Claude and find out what your AI actually thinks about itself:

I want you to be ruthlessly honest about your own limitations for the next 5 minutes. No diplomatic hedging, no "I can certainly try" energy. I'm going to describe how I use you, and I want you to tell me: where are you failing silently? Where am I trusting output I shouldn't? Where have I probably built a workflow that works despite you, not because of you?

Here's how I use you: [describe your 3-5 most common AI tasks]

Now roast your own performance. Be specific. Name the failure modes. Tell me what I should be checking that I'm not.
